I wonder where the convenience control panel goes, with the bench seat option. They're on the center dash piece if no A/C, or on the lower console front panel if console option.

I see $20K/$25K to bring this car back-if no major issues (the rusty vinyl covered top, frame, body panels). And that's doing the work yourself. Add on the purchase price, shipping, insurance, and you go way beyond costs versus value. JMHO.
